Recuperating Super Eagles and Nottingham Forest striker, Taiwo Awoniyi, has heaped praises on teammates, fans, management and staff of the club for their support and prayers in his moment of agony.

The former Union Berlin ace crashed into a post during Forest’s 2-2 draw with Leicester last week leading to emergency surgery for an abnominal injury.

The 27-year-old had to be put in an induced coma earlier this week, and is recovering well from what  could have been life-threatning situation.

Forest Coach, Nuno Espirito Santo, revealed early Sunday (today), that Awoniyi will remain in hospital for at least a few more days.

Despite the situation he has found himself, Awoniyi took time  to wish his teammates well ahead of their clash against West Ham United and also thanked them and the club for their support in his difficult moment, even as he remained optimistic that the club will ultimately finish well enough to play in the Champions League next season.

He said, “This season has been one of the most difficult of my career, but through it all, I have felt the love. With the grace of God, I am grateful to still be here, to still be fighting, to still be smiling, and to be in good spirits.

“To my teammates, coaches, staff, and the entire Forest family, thank you for your well wishes. Seeing you all on your visit to the hospital lifted my spirits more than words can say.

“Wishing the boys the very best in these last two games, keep believing and keep pushing. I’m with you all the way, and I can’t wait to be back out there with the boys doing what I love

“To my family, friends, and football fans, thank you for the support, and to everyone back home in Nigeria who has checked in on me, prayed for me, and left kind words, thank you. I see them. I feel them. And I carry them with me every day as I recover”

Forest meanwhile, got a huge boost after beating West Ham 2-1 on Sunday. Mogam Gibbs-white grabbed the opener for visiting Forest before Nikola Milenković increased the tally. West Ham had a consolation goal in the 86th minute, thanks to Jarrod Bowen.

After spending most of the season in the top five, Forest have slipped out of the Champions League spots.

Even two victories at this stage of the competition might not be enough, as they now must rely on their opponents to drop points. Before the clash against West Ham, Forest players had donned Awoniyi’s name and number on the back of their warm-up shirts, with a heartfelt message on the front declaring their support for him all the way.

Coach Nuno Espirito Santo and his players dedicated the 2-1 win over West Ham which kept their Champions League hopes alive to Taiwo Awoniyi.
